The ‘Emerging Technologies for the Integration of Autonomous Vehicles into Networked Naval Operations' program will deliver graduates capable of tackling Australia's pressing current and future challenges in the defence, maritime and aerospace industry sectors. Effectively integrating crewed vessels and autonomous maritime/aerial vehicles requires technological advancements, robust legal and regulatory frameworks, skilled and knowledgeable operators navigating complex challenges, and careful coordination and seamless communication.

The Sir Lawrence Wackett Defence and Aerospace Centre at RMIT University and the Defence and Maritime Innovation and Design Precinct at the Australian Maritime College, University of Tasmania jointly propose to tackle these challenges with a cohort of students working toward developing the knowledge and technology required to design, operate, and maintain uncrewed surface/undersea/aerial vehicles including Robotics and AI, legal and regulatory frameworks, cybersecurity, human-factors and machine interactions, and environmental concerns.

The program will build on the institutions' long-standing relationships with Australia's Department of Defence, defence-industry prime and small-to-medium enterprises, and remote and regional communities.

This proposal intends to provide enabling research, testing, and evaluation, for realising the capability road map within the RAN's Robotics Autonomous-Systems and Artificial Intelligence Strategy and to help address the critical shortages of specialised R&D personnel currently affecting the Australian defence sector.
